Who Needs a Fishing License in Missouri
Missouri residents sixteen through sixty four need a license.
Non residents sixteen years and older need a license.
Kids under sixteen do not need a license in Missouri. This makes family trips easy since nobody under sixteen has to buy anything to fish.
Missouri resident seniors sixty five and older can fish without a license but should carry proof of age and residency.
Types of Licenses Non Residents Need to Know
Non Resident Daily Fishing Permit: Valid for one calendar day. Good for short trips or tournament days.
Non Resident Three Day Fishing Permit: Valid for three consecutive days. The most popular option for Branson visitors.
Non Resident Annual Fishing Permit: Valid for a full calendar year. Worth it if you plan to fish Missouri multiple times a year.
A three day permit typically covers a half day guided trip plus a day of fishing off a resort dock plus a family morning on Taneycomo. It is the default pick for most visiting families.
The Missouri Trout Permit
To fish for trout on Lake Taneycomo you also need a Missouri trout permit on top of your fishing license. This applies to non residents and residents alike.
Resident trout permit and non resident trout permit both exist. Both are inexpensive and valid for a calendar year. Buy them at the same time as your fishing license.
In the trophy trout management area of Lake Taneycomo from Table Rock Dam down to Fall Creek, additional regulations apply. Artificials only. Specific length limits. I manage all of those details on every trip.
Where to Buy a Missouri Fishing License
Online at mdc.mo.gov. The fastest and easiest option. You can print the license or pull it up on your phone on the water.
Walmart stores across Missouri sell licenses at the sporting goods counter.
Bass Pro Shops Tracker Boat Center in Springfield sells all licenses and permits.
Local Branson marinas, bait shops, and tackle shops typically sell licenses.
Buy your license before the trip, not at 5 AM at the dock. Servers sometimes go down early in the morning. Last minute hunting for a place to buy a license is a stressful way to start a trip.
What You Need to Buy a License
Driver's license or state issued ID.
Social Security Number or Missouri conservation number if you have one from a prior purchase.
Payment method, typically a credit card online.
For non residents, your home state driver's license is what you will use for identification.

Frequently Asked Questions
Can Keith sell me a fishing license on the boat?
No. Fishing licenses must be purchased directly from the Missouri Department of Conservation or an authorized vendor before your trip.
Do I need a trout permit for Table Rock Lake?
No. The Missouri trout permit applies to Lake Taneycomo and other trout waters. Table Rock Lake requires only a standard fishing license.
What is the penalty for fishing without a license?
Missouri conservation enforcement issues fines and can confiscate gear. Licenses are inexpensive. Always have a current one.
Can I buy a license the morning of the trip?
Yes, online if the system is running. The safer choice is to buy it the day before so a server hiccup does not delay your trip.
